Safety First

When choosing furniture for kids, safety should always be your top priority. Look for pieces that adhere to safety standards and avoid those with sharp edges, small detachable parts, or toxic materials. Opt for furniture made from non-toxic paints and finishes. Stability is crucial; ensure that heavier items like dressers and bookshelves can be anchored to the wall to prevent tipping. Rounded edges are preferable to prevent injuries from accidental bumps.

Durability and Quality

Children can be rough on furniture, so durability is a key factor. Furniture made from high-quality materials like solid wood or metal tends to be more long-lasting compared to cheaper alternatives like particle board. Check for sturdy construction and robust joints. It might be beneficial to read reviews or get recommendations from other parents to gauge how well specific items hold up over time.

Age Appropriateness

The furniture should be suitable for your child's age and developmental stage. For instance, a toddler will need a crib or a toddler bed, while an older child might require a twin or full-size bed. Similarly, a small table and chairs set is perfect for a preschooler but might be outgrown quickly by a school-age child. Adjustable furniture can accommodate your child’s growth, allowing you to make adjustments as they get older.

Comfort and Ergonomics

Comfort is another essential factor. Choose beds with quality mattresses that support growing bodies. Chairs and desks should be ergonomically designed to promote good posture. Avoid furniture that is either too big or too small for your child, as this can lead to discomfort and potential health issues.

Aesthetic Appeal

While practicality is paramount, the visual appeal of the furniture should not be overlooked. Children are more likely to enjoy their space if it reflects their interests and personalities. Opt for colors, patterns, and designs that your child loves. However, keep in mind that tastes can change rapidly, so you might want to choose more neutral base pieces and add colorful, interchangeable accents like cushions, wall decals, and bedding.

Storage Solutions

Kids accumulate a lot of stuff, from toys to books to clothes. Efficient storage solutions are crucial for keeping their space organized. Look for furniture pieces that offer built-in storage, such as beds with drawers underneath, bookshelves with baskets, or desks with ample drawer space. Multi-purpose items can help maximize space, especially in smaller rooms.

Ease of Maintenance

Children’s furniture is bound to get dirty, so ease of maintenance is essential. Look for materials that are easy to clean and maintain. Removable, washable covers on sofas and chairs can be a lifesaver. Darker colors and patterns can help hide stains and wear better than lighter shades.

Budget Considerations

While it might be tempting to go for the cheapest options, investing in quality furniture often yields better value in the long run. However, there are ways to be cost-effective without compromising on quality. Consider purchasing second-hand furniture, which can often be found in excellent condition. Furniture stores often have sales, especially during holidays, which can offer significant savings.

Involving Your Child

Lastly, involving your child in the decision-making process can make the experience more enjoyable for both of you. Let them have a say in choosing colors, themes, or even specific items. This not only ensures that they are happy with their space but also teaches them to make thoughtful choices.
